Consider the type of gas your home is using and whether you'll have the ability to switch between propane and natural gas for your oven. Choose an oven that is compatible with your current gas supply and follow the manufacturer's instructions for installation, usage and maintenance. Make sure that your oven is vented properly to prevent fumes from entering the air and ensure the proper circulation of air.

If you are looking for a brand new built-in single gas grill and oven, remember that it's essential to have it installed professionally by a licensed technician. The right engineer will ensure that your appliance is in line with all safety guidelines, and is connected properly to the gas and electrical systems. Built-in appliances unlike freestanding stoves or ovens, require professional installation to ensure that they are installed correctly and safely. This is especially the case for gas-powered units which requires adequate ventilation and safety standards to function effectively. A trained professional can evaluate the layout of your kitchen and suggest the best location for your built in single oven.

There are a myriad of options for a built-in oven, the most common is to install it underneath an island or countertop. This configuration is often chosen to make space and to create a seamless look with the rest of your kitchen.

Another option is to place the oven within an island in your kitchen. This can be an area for work and make it easier to access your oven, while still allowing adequate air circulation.

After you have decided how and where you want to place your new built-in single oven, you'll have to decide between an under-counter or eye level installation. An under-counter built in oven is a great option if you are limited with space for cabinets or countertops because it can be placed under the countertop. This design can also give a an elegant and modern appearance in your kitchen.

The eye-level oven is a permanent fixture in the kitchen. They can be set on top of a counter or an individual lower cabinet and are often positioned close to or at eye level to make it easier. They can also be integrated into your kitchen island, creating an elegant and seamless look.
